Patient-Grade Wet Wipes: Formulation & Safety
Patient-grade wet wipes are intended for sensitive skin and require a unique mixture of ingredients to ensure both efficacy and safety. These wipes are often utilized in medical settings for disinfecting wounds, prepping skin for procedures, or simply providing soothing cleansing for patients. Formulators must carefully consider the alkalinity of the wipes to avoid irritation. Common ingredients include distilled water, mild surfactants, and emollients to maintain moisture. Rigorous safety testing is essential to ensure that the wipes are devoid of harmful compounds and are appropriate for patient use.

Understanding Wet Wipe Liquid Composition
Wet wipes have become a ubiquitous necessity in homes and businesses. These pre-moistened cloths offer a hassle-free way to clean hands, surfaces, and even delicate items. But have you ever stopped to consider what exactly is found in that seemingly simple liquid? The composition of wet wipe solution can vary widely depending on the intended use and brand.
A typical wet wipe solution usually includes water as its base . This is often combined with humectants like glycerin to help keep the wipes moist and prevent them from drying out too quickly. Surfactants, which are substances that reduce surface tension, are also commonly found in wet wipe solutions. They facilitate the cleaning process by breaking down dirt, grime, Operating room wipes liquid and other contaminants .
Some wet wipes may also contain additional ingredients such as preservatives to extend shelf life , fragrances for a more pleasant aroma , and lubricants to provide a smoother feel. It's important to note that certain ingredients may not be suitable for all individuals, particularly those with sensitive skin.
